Leicester City midfielder Youri Tielemans is a target for Manchester United. The team from Old Trafford seems to need such a midfielder in team, and he would be of great importance to them. Tielemans showed how good he is in the Premier League, and United's leaders are already familiar with his qualities.

However, Tielemans is frustrated by the rumors about his new club in an interview with the Belgian media. There are many clubs in the game, but he seems to have ambitions to stay in Leicester. "I try not to think about it much and focus on my own performance, it works well," Tielemans told Belgian outlet Het Belang van Limburg earlier this year, as quoted by manchestereveningnews.

"But it's actually amazing how much they talk about my future. Every day they name a different club. "I have the feeling that people think that after this season I will be out of contract when I still have one year left. I feel good here, I like living here, my children go to school here.

I'm happy both outside and inside football. And Leicester have ambition."

Youri Tielemans and his future

Tielemans confirmed that he would like to stay, but it seems that it is not a definitive decision and that if there is a specific offer, he could leave Leicester.

There are many offers Youri will have to consider, but at this moment the most important thing for him is his family, so the family will have a big role in what Tielemans will decide. Maybe that's why Manchester United could be a good option.

"I am very calm about [my future]. My contract expires in 2023 and it's not that I absolutely want to leave. I haven't made my decision yet. If I have to stay another year, I will gladly do so. The club has been really great towards me.

They remain very professional, just like me. That will not change. "There are talks between the club and my advisors. That will remain so. It's not that I'm ignoring the club. I will study my options in the summer and make a decision.

My family is the most important to me. I'm not going somewhere where I know my family isn't happy. As a father of two children, you have to think about that, too."
